CONTINGENCY FUNDING PLAN. (1) Within sixty (60) days, the Board shall adopt a comprehensive Bank-specific Contingency Funding Plan consistent with the guidelines set forth in the “Liquidity” booklet of the Comptroller’s Handbook and the Interagency Policy Statement on Funding and Liquidity Risk Management, OCC Bulletin 2010-13, March 22, 2010.
